Common Issues with Doors and Windows
Before diving into repair methods, it's essential to acknowledge typical concerns faced by doors and windows. Here's a list of issues that may require attention:
Doors:Warping: Caused by humidity modifications, doors might bow or twist.Scratches and Dents: Physical effect can leave unwanted marks.Sticking: Misalignments or swelling can make doors hard to open.Lock Malfunctions: Locking systems may end up being jammed or broken.Windows:Drafts: Air leaks due to poor sealing or old weather condition stripping.Split Glass: Damage from impacts or severe weather condition conditions.Foggy Glass: Failure of double-glazed units, leading to moisture build-up.Rodent Damage: Infestations can result in broken frames or sashes.Tools and Materials Needed

Examine the Damage
Observe and recognize the type of damage. Inspect hinges, locks, and the door frame for any structural problems.
Fixing Warped or Sticking Doors
Change Hinges: Tighten or loosen screws on hinges to align the door properly.Sand Edges: If the door sticks, gently sand down the edges using sandpaper up until it opens smoothly.
Repairing Scratches and Dents
Wood Filler: Apply wood filler to scratches, let it dry, and sand it flush with the surface. Finish by painting or staining to match the door's color.
Replacing the Lock
Remove the old lock following the producer's instructions. Install the new lock by securing it in location with the supplied screws.Repairing Windows
Inspect the Window Frame
Inspect for rot, warping, or instability in the frame. Use a level to guarantee it's square.
Repairing Drafts
Eliminate Old Weather Stripping: Take off the used removing with an energy knife.Install New Weather Stripping: Measure and cut the new stripping to size, then push it into place.
Repairing Cracked Glass
If the fracture is minor, utilizing epoxy may suffice. For considerable damage, eliminate the broken glass using an energy knife and change it with new glass, securing it with putty.
Addressing Foggy Windows
If the double-glazed system stops working, consider changing the entire unit. Seek advice from a professional if the job appears overwhelming or needs specialized tools.Maintenance Tips

How frequently should I examine my windows and doors?
Regular evaluations are recommended two times a year to ensure that any prospective concerns are identified early.
2. Can I change glass in a window myself?
Yes, if you have the right tools and are comfy with the procedure. Nevertheless, for substantial damage or double-glazed units, it's recommended to consult a professional.
3. What are the signs that I require to change my door or window?
Common indications include substantial warping, trouble in opening/closing, and visible damage such as fractures or big dents.
4. How do I fix a door that will not lock?
Make sure the lock is lined up with the strike plate. You may require to change the hinges or move the strike plate a little to achieve proper alignment.
5. Is weather condition stripping required?
Yes, weather condition removing is essential for energy effectiveness and maintaining a comfortable indoor environment, preventing drafts and wetness from entering.
